Need Distinct count of Product ID based on Filter Criteria

Hi ,

 

I need help in figuring out the solution for a measure in Analysis Tabular Cube. CountProduct is the measure I am trying to create. I need to find count of products based on the below criteria ( scenarions listed in the table below) and the count should be visible at any grain when sliced. Also Grand Total should be just the total count of products for any given selection

 

Scenario NetSupply[Existing measure : Supply- Demand ]CountProduct
No Demand No Supply0Blank
Product With Supply and no Demand or 0 Zero Demand> 0Blank
Product With no Supply and has Demand< 00
Product with Supply and Demand01
Product with Supply and Demand<00
Product with Supply and Demand>01

 

Demand, Supply & Net Supply are existing measures in Cube. if a product is has 2 segment ID's and has demand and supply , I need to double count when looking at the higher grain which is why i used Summarize function to group by productid and segmentid.
